💡 What does 🇧🇶 mean?
The Caribbean Netherlands Flag emoji 🇧🇶 belongs to the Country Flag group within Flags and is commonly used when conversations touch on Country Flag. It's supported on every modern platform and works in texts, social media posts, emails, and more.
Use it in group chats, story reactions, or email subject lines. It's universally understood and renders correctly on every platform.
You'll frequently see 🇧🇶 paired with 🏁 Chequered Flag, 🚩 Triangular Flag On Post, 🎌 Crossed Flags in real conversations — they complement each other naturally.

⌨️ How to type 🇧🇶
Windows
Win + . → search "caribbean netherlands flag"
Mac
Cmd + Ctrl + Space
Linux
Ctrl + . (GNOME)
Mobile
Emoji keyboard 🔤
